Description
A delicious and creamy potato soup recipe inspired by the Pioneer Woman, perfect for cozy nights.
Ingredients

- 6 medium potatoes, peeled and diced
- 1 medium onion, chopped
- 4 cups chicken broth
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1/2 cup butter
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1 cup shredded cheese (optional)
- Chopped green onions for garnish (optional)
Instructions
- In a large pot, melt the butter over medium heat.
- Add the chopped onion and sauté until translucent.
- Add the diced potatoes and chicken broth, bringing to a boil.
- Reduce heat and simmer until potatoes are tender, about 15-20 minutes.
- Use a potato masher to mash some of the potatoes for a creamy texture.
- Stir in the heavy cream and season with salt and pepper.
- If desired, add shredded cheese and stir until melted.
- Serve hot, garnished with chopped green onions.
Notes
- For a vegetarian version, use vegetable broth instead of chicken broth.
- This soup can be made ahead and st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
- Freeze leftovers for a quick meal later.
